Summary

Multicenter randomized controlled trial which will include patients with left ventricular ejection fraction \>50% requiring a first implant of a cardiac pacemaker with expected high pacing percentages. Patients will be randomized 1:1 to right ventricular apical pacing vs left septal or deep septal pacing. The primary endpoint will be pacing-induced cardiomyopathy during the first year of follow-up.

DEVICEPacemaker implantAll patients in the study will have a clear indication for a permanent pacemaker. The type of device (single or dual chamber) will be chosen as per clinical practice. The only difference between the two groups of the study will be the position of the ventricular lead.
